Bitcoin and other alternative cryptocurrencies, commonly referred to as altcoins, have experienced a notable surge in value recently. This positive price movement, often known as “popping to the upside” in trading circles, signifies an increase in demand and investor interest in these digital assets.
The surge in Bitcoin and altcoin prices can be attributed to various factors, including growing adoption worldwide, increasing institutional interest, and positive sentiment in the crypto market. As a result, many investors are optimistic about the future potential of these digital currencies.
However, it is essential to note that while the current rally is exciting, upcoming macro events could potentially impact the trajectory of Bitcoin and altcoins in the near future. These macro events, which refer to broader economic, political, or regulatory developments, have the potential to influence market sentiment and shape price trends.
One of the key macro events that traders and investors are closely monitoring is regulatory developments around the world. Governments and regulatory bodies are increasingly focused on developing frameworks to govern the use of cryptocurrencies, which could impact their value and market dynamics.
Additionally, geopolitical events, economic indicators, and technological advancements in the blockchain space could also play a role in shaping the future of Bitcoin and altcoins. As a result, it is crucial for investors to stay informed and be aware of the broader factors that could influence the market.
Despite these potential macro challenges, the overall sentiment in the cryptocurrency market remains positive, with many experts and analysts forecasting further growth and adoption in the coming months.
